Winter Meet of the Y. A. A.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The Yale Athletic Association will hold its annual winter meeting in conjunction with the Connecticut National Guard at the Second Regiment Armory in New Haven on Saturday evening, March 7. The following events will be open only to the Connecticut National Guard: 50 yards dash, handicap; one mile relay race, boxing, tug-of-war. The following events, all handicap, will be open to all amateurs: 50 yards dash, 50 yards hurdle, 600 yards run, one mile run, putting 16 pound shot, pole vault, running high jump. Other events may be arranged later. The first two men in each event will receive silver cups and the companies which win the relay race and the tug-of-war will have trophies presented to them.
